Aramis Group (ARAMI) H2 2025 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
H2 2025 earnings summary
27 Nov, 2025Executive summary
FY 2025 delivered profitable growth with record B2C deliveries of 119,000 units (+6% YoY) and revenue of €2,380 million, outperforming the market across six geographies.
Adjusted EBITDA rose 34% year-over-year to €67.8 million, and net income quadrupled to €19.9 million.
Net debt was reduced from €61 million to €6.1 million through strong cash generation of €66 million.
High customer and employee satisfaction, with NPS at 73 and eNPS at 53 as of September 2025.
Strategy execution progressed, though at a slower pace in the UK and Austria due to founder transitions and operational alignment, making FY 2026 a transition year.
Financial highlights
Revenue grew 6% year-over-year to €2,380 million, with B2C growth of 7.1% and B2C segment accounting for 89% of revenues.
Adjusted EBITDA increased from €51 million to €67.8 million, in line with guidance.
Gross profit per B2C vehicle sold (GPU) improved 3.2% to €2,359, best in class in Europe.
Operating income more than doubled to €28.9 million, and net profit surged 296.3% to €19.9 million.
Cash generation reached €66 million, supporting earn-out and share buyback payments while reducing net debt.
Outlook and guidance
FY 2026 guidance: at least 115,000 B2C deliveries and adjusted EBITDA of at least €55 million, reflecting a cautious approach amid ongoing transitions and market uncertainty.
Midterm ambitions reaffirmed: high single-digit average annual organic B2C volume growth and around 5% adjusted EBITDA margin, now expected over a longer horizon.
Execution pace of strategic plan to be gradual, reflecting macroeconomic and political uncertainties.
